What Makes Your Drains In Brisbane Get Blocked?
Stormwater drainage systems in Brisbane block due to our unique climate and local environment. Heavy rain washes debris into your drain pipe, while tree roots seek water sources, creating the perfect storm for serious blockages that threaten your property.
Brisbane’s clay soils make drainage issues worse by expanding when wet and contracting when dry, shifting and damaging pipes over time. Our increasing rainfall, noted by CSIRO, puts extra pressure on existing stormwater systems.
Common Causes of Blocked Drains:
Tree root intrusion breaking through pipe joints
Leaves and garden waste from Brisbane’s abundant vegetation
Soil and mud washed in during summer storms
Building materials and household waste
Structural damage to aging stormwater pipes
How Do You Know When You Need Drain Clearing?
Your storm water drains show clear warning signs when a blockage forms, with water pooling being the most obvious indicator. After rain, water should drain quickly – if it stays around your home, you likely need a plumber to help with drain cleaning.
Overflow from grates and drain covers shows that water can’t flow properly through your plumbing system. You might also notice unpleasant smells or gurgling sounds when water tries to escape.
Watch For These Warning Signs:
Water backing up during rainfall
Damp patches appearing on lawns
Sudden growth of moss near drainage areas
Water entering your home or damaging foundations
Cracks appearing around drainage points


Why Are Blocked Storm Drains Dangerous For Your Home?
A blocked sewer or stormwater drain threatens Brisbane homes due to our intense rainfall and flood-prone geography. Water unable to escape causes foundation problems by eroding soil beneath structures or creating pressure against building materials.
Brisbane’s overland flow paths – the routes water naturally takes during heavy rain – become dangerous when drains fail. Brisbane City Council identifies these paths in their City Plan, showing how critical proper drainage solutions are for properties in these zones.
Problems That Might Develop:
Pollutants entering local waterways
Sediment runoff damaging natural areas
Stagnant water breeding mosquitoes
Erosion damaging your yard
Increased flood risk to neighboring properties

Who Needs To Fix Your Blocked Storm Drain?
Property owners must maintain all stormwater and sewer drain systems within their boundaries. Local council guidelines outline this responsibility clearly. You need to keep your gutters, downpipes, and all drainage infrastructure on your property working properly.
The council handles infrastructure outside your property, including street drains and the main sewer network. This shared approach ensures the entire system works effectively during heavy rainfall events.
Your Responsibilities Include:
Maintaining private stormwater pipes
Ensuring proper “lawful points of discharge” where water exits
Implementing Erosion and Sediment Control measures during construction
Keeping drains free from garden waste
Reporting issues with council infrastructure
How Can You Stop Your Drains From Getting Blocked?
Prevent drain blockage with regular maintenance and protective measures suited to Brisbane’s climate. Install quality gutter guards to keep leaves and debris from entering your drainage system while allowing water to flow freely – especially important during our intense summer storms.
Clean gutters and drain covers regularly, particularly before storm season, to remove buildup before it causes problems. For properties in Brisbane’s flow paths, additional preventative measures protect against flooding.
Effective Prevention Steps:
Keep garden waste away from drain areas
Trim trees near stormwater pipes to limit root growth
Schedule professional drain inspection before storm season
Install drain covers to prevent debris entry
Consider root barriers for properties with established trees

Stormwater Drains vs Sewer Drains: What's the Difference?
Many Brisbane property owners confuse stormwater drains with sewer drains, but they serve completely different purposes and require different expertise:
Stormwater Drainage Systems
- Purpose: Manage surface water and rainfall runoff
- Location: Outdoor areas—driveways, gardens, yards, roofs
- Connects to: Street stormwater systems and natural waterways
- Common issues: Leaf buildup, garden debris, sediment, tree roots
- Maintenance: Seasonal cleaning before wet season
Sewer Drainage Systems
- Purpose: Remove wastewater from toilets, sinks, showers
- Location: Indoor plumbing fixtures
- Connects to: Council sewer mains
- Common issues: Grease, hair, sanitary products, pipe damage
- Maintenance: As needed for household use
Why This Matters
Treating a stormwater blockage as a sewer issue—or vice versa—can lead to ineffective solutions and wasted money. Our team specializes in outdoor stormwater drainage and understands the unique challenges of managing surface water in Brisbane’s climate.

Protect Your Property: Seasonal Stormwater Maintenance
Brisbane’s weather patterns demand proactive stormwater drain maintenance to prevent flooding and property damage. Follow our seasonal guide to keep your outdoor drainage system functioning optimally:
Before Wet Season (October – December)
✓ Clear all stormwater grates and pits of debris
✓ Inspect downpipes and gutter connections
✓ Trim overhanging branches that drop leaves into drains
✓ Schedule professional CCTV inspection for peace of mind
✓ Test drainage flow with a hose to identify slow spots
During Storm Season (January – March)
✓ Monitor stormwater grates during heavy rainfall
✓ Clear visible debris immediately after storms
✓ Watch for pooling water or slow drainage
✓ Keep emergency plumber contact details handy
✓ Document any flooding for insurance purposes
After Storm Season (April – June)
✓ Clean accumulated sediment from stormwater pits
✓ Inspect for damage caused by heavy rainfall
✓ Address any erosion around drainage areas
✓ Consider high-pressure jetting for thorough cleaning
Dry Season Preparation (July – September)
✓ Plan major stormwater repairs or upgrades
✓ Install additional drainage if flooding occurred
✓ Replace damaged grates or covers
✓ Prepare garden and landscaping to minimize debris
